Equipped with built-in recorder, ECG and Pacing, HP code master defibrillator is fabricated by using modern machinery and technology. In addition to this, HP code master defibrillator is equipped with AC power with battery back-up.

Features:

•Rechargeable and sealed lead-acid battery
•2.5 hours monitoring or 50 full-energy discharges
•AC input: 100 to 230 VAC +/- 15%

Specifications :

• Dimensions
•7.9"H x 11.8"W x 15.6"L, 20cm x 30cm x 39.7cm
• Weight 24 lbs. / 10.9kg

Battery :

•Type: Rechargeable, sealed lead-acid battery. 4 Ah, 12 V nominal.
•Charge Time: 2 hours to 90% of full capacity. 18 hours to 100% capacity. Repeated charging to less than 100% will reduce the useful life of the battery.
•Capacity: 2.5 hours monitoring or 50 full-energy discharges or 1 hour monitoring and recording.
•AC input: 100 to 230 VAC +/- 15%, 50/60 Hz.
•Battery Indicators: Illuminated LED indicates battery is charging. Low Battery message appears on the monitor.

Synchronizer :

•SYNC message appears on the monitor and is annotated periodically on the recorder while in synchronous mode. An audible beep sounds with each detected R-wave; while a marker on the monitor and sync mark on the recorder strip indicate the discharge point.
• Paddles: standard paddles are anterior / anterior. Adult electrodes (83 cm sq) slide off to expose pediatric electrodes (21 cm sq). Paddle cord is 10 feet (3m). Full range of internal paddles are available.

Monitor :

• Input: ECG activity may be viewed through the paddles or patient cable.
• Lead fault: LEADS OFF message and dashed baseline appear on the monitor if a lead Becomes disconnected. Common mode rejection: greater than 100dB measured as per AAMI standards for cardiac monitors.
• Heart rate display: digital read out on monitor from 20 to 280 bpm.

Real CPR Help and See-Thru CPR technology allow the rescuer to see depth and rate of compression as well as monitor underlying ECG rhythm while performing CPR. See-Thru CPR reduces the duration of pauses during CPR so rescuers are able to see whether an organized underlying rhythm has developed without stopping compressions. Real CPR Help guides rescuers with text and audio feedback on CPR quality measures with numeric data based on real time depth and rate of compressions.

The R Series Plus Defibrillator also features Rectilinear Biphasic Waveform (RBW) that was designed for external defibrillation to control for variations in patient impedance through a series of digitally-controlled internal resistors. This feature provides the maximum average current held for the optimum duration. RBW provides more current than the typical "high energy" biphasic that other defibrillators use, and has proven to be more effective than monophasic waveforms, especially on high-impedance patients.

The R Series works with the Zoll OneStep Pacing system. With OneStep Pacing and Zoll OneStep electrodes, the need for a separate ECG cable is eliminated. The ECG electrodes are incorporated with an anterior OneStep electrode. The electrodes are triangular and incorporate a circular multi-function therapy electrode in the middle and three ECG electrodes at the ends of the triangular electrode pad shape. While the therapy portion emits a pacing pulse, the ECG electrodes acquire signals from the heart and function as the monitoring element. Electrodes for this function are sold separately from the Defibrillator Unit.

The M7 epitomizes the optimal combination of advanced imaging and miniaturization technologies. This portable system employs the System On Chip (SOC) design, enabling complex technologies to be built into its compact laptop-style chassis. These SOC-based designs produce energy efficient and highly reliable compact machines. The M7 delivers extraordinary image quality, user experience, and versatility for a hand-carried ultrasound imaging system. Its compact, lightweight design gives it convenient access to all point of care environments. And its superior computing power results in an instantaneous response to user commands and a short cycle time.

Features include: 15″ high-resolution TFT LCD display with 170° viewing angle; fast power up; sealed surface for easy infection control; iTouch™ one button image optimization; user programmable exam presets; iStation™; octal-beam imaging technology, providing excellent temporal resolution; iClear™ speckle suppression technology; iBeam™ spatial compounding; iZoom™; iScape™ panoramic imaging; iNeedle™ needle visualization technology; TDI (Tissue Doppler Imaging); IMT auto-measurement of carotid intimae-thickness; full-featured DICOM function; wired and iRoam™, wireless, data transfer and connectivity.

In AED mode, the HeartStart XL+ defibrillator/monitor can defibrillate any patient, of any age without using special accessories, which can help save valuable time when responding to an emergency. Quick Shock in AED mode and a fast charge time to the standard adult dose in manual mode (3 seconds) help minimize CPR interruptions and speed shock delivery.

Ease-of-use is the hallmark of the Philips family of defibrillators, including the HeartStart XL+, the HeartStart MRx, and HeartStart AEDs. All Philips defibrillators have similar user interfaces and AED prompts. Standardizing with Philips can make training more efficient and give users confidence.

An active visual indicator shows the defibrillator has power and is ready to use. Green front panel lights indicate AC and battery power. No need to check that the AC power cord is connected or if the battery is charged and ready for use.

Patient monitoring measurements, including 3- and 5-lead ECG, heart rate, SpO2, and Non-Invasive Blood Pressure, provide continuity of care from the cardiac emergency to patient monitoring at the bedside in a single device. Measurements can be trended over time, displayed, and printed.

HeartStart Adult/Child or Infant defibrillation pads are designed for manual or AED mode, pacing, cardioversion, and monitoring. No need for specialty pads for infant/child AED mode.

Traditional power meters are broadband and have limited power ranges, so engineers and technicians are using spectrum analyzers which include many unneeded features, cost hundreds of thousands of dollars, and take up half the test bench just to make simple, frequency-based RF amplitude measurements. Power Master enables those measurements in a USB-powered device slightly bigger than a smartphone and at a fraction of the price of a spectrum analyzer.

A transport solution should be easy to carry and avoid time-consuming recabling. It must also provide advanced networking capabilities, guaranteeing the continuity of all data. With its carefully designed features, BeneView T1 perfectly matches these requirements.

BeneView T1 is both multi-parameter module and transport monitor at the same time. As a module, it connects to the BeneView bedside patient monitor, supporting all standard parameters. It can be quickly unplugged to follow the patient throughout the points of care, allowing for comprehensive patient monitoring also during transport. Thus, BeneView T1 offers seamless data transfer and guarantees the continuity of monitoring information. When connected wirelessly to the Hypervisor VI central monitoring system, all information from BeneView T1 can be viewed from the nurse station or from any bedside monitor in the network.

Cableless devices free up patients and offer reliability
Gain greater freedom of movement and ambulation for patients while providing reliable and secure transfer of vital signs to the central station through the existing network infrastructure. Philips cableless devices can be used anywhere greater mobility is desired, such as in critical and intermediate care areas, medical-surgical and telemetry units, and during transport.

Secure transmission to support decision making
Philips small, lightweight cableless devices transmit vital signs information to a central nurse’s station via an IntelliVue patient monitor or telemetry transmitter to help clinicians with the early identification of deteriorating conditions.

Extra measurement features extend monitoring capabilities
Add measurements beyond ECG, such as NBP and optional SpO₂, eliminating the need for an additional SpO₂ and NBP monitor. The solution uses short-range radio (SRR) so you can provide these capabilities without additional capital investment.

Rechargeable Li-ion battery for long life
An integral rechargeable battery is designed for long life and an efficient use of resources, reducing the need to frequently order and dispose of batteries.

Small and lightweight for enhanced patient comfort
The cableless measurement pods are easy to apply and easy to wear. Their lightweight design enhances patient comfort and does not interfere with the goals of treatment.

Cableless technology reduces cable clutter
Fewer measurement cables help enhance patient mobility by eliminating the wire between the SpO₂ and/or NBP sensor and the monitor, while also decreasing the potential hazard of clinical staff disconnecting the cables by accident.
